WebSep 28, 2024 · Chest pain that occurs while lying down may be the result of acid reflux, which is a common problem caused by gastro-oesophageal reflux disease (GERD). This condition occurs when stomach acid backs up into the oesophagus. Symptoms of this condition may be worsened by lying down or bending over.
